Ingredients

cooking spray

¼ cup all purpose flour

2 cups all purpose flour

1¼ cups granulated sugar

1¼ tbsp baking powder

1 tsp salt

3 tbsp dry milk powder

3 tbsp cornstarch

¼ cup vegetable oil

4 large eggs

½ cup lemon juice

½ cup limoncello

½ cup water

⅓ cup unsalted butter

½ cup white sugar

1 tbsp water

⅓ cup limoncello

rainbow sprinkles

Preparation

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.

Grease a 10-inch bundt pan and dust with the flour. Set aside.

For the cake mix, sift together flour, sugar, salt, baking powder, milk powder, and cornstarch. Set aside.

Whisk together the eggs, water, oil, limoncello, and lemon juice until evenly incorporated.

Fold the sifted dry ingredients into the egg mixture until evenly incorporated.

Slowly pour the mixture in the cake pan.

Place in the oven, and bake it for 45 to 55 minutes.

When the cake is done, take it out of the oven and let it cool for 20 minutes.

While waiting for the cake to cool, melt butter and cook it with water and sugar. Bring it to boil for 3 minutes. Remove your pot from the heat and add in limoncello to make the glaze.

Pour the glaze over the cake, sprinkle some rainbow sprinkles for color, and it’s ready to serve!
